West Lake Forest real estate Market Report.

Information and statistics on the latest trends in the West Lake Forest real estate market, updated for April 2026. *

Year over year, typical home values in West Lake Forest have slipped about 10.44 percent, and homes are taking roughly 29.11 percent longer to sell than a year ago. New listings are also down 37.5 percent from last year, even as pending sales have risen by about 11.11 percent. Compared with the broader New Orleans area, where the typical value is around $315,000, West Lake Forest’s values are notably lower.

In February 2026, the typical home value sat near $201,500 while the median list price hovered around $249,000, and homes spent a median of 102 days on the market. Only about 20 percent of recent sales closed above the asking price, and the average sale-to-list ratio was close to 0.98, indicating modest discounting rather than steep bidding wars.

Inventory in February was very limited, with just 5 homes available, down about 37.5 percent month over month and roughly 61.54 percent lower than a year ago. Looking ahead to March 2026, values are projected to ease to about $169,625, median list prices to around $243,500, and inventory to roughly 3 homes, which reinforces the current seller’s market conditions. West Lake Forest in New Orleans stands out from nearby areas by offering a quieter residential setting with quick access to city conveniences. Tucked along the eastern edge of the city near Bayou Sauvage National Wildlife Refuge, it appeals to residents who value space, off-street parking, and a more relaxed pace while still living in New Orleans.

Single family homes and townhomes line broad streets, with schools like Dwight D. Eisenhower Academy of Global Studies and Lake Forest Elementary Charter serving the community. Shopping and daily errands are straightforward, with nearby retail along Chef Menteur Highway and quick routes to New Orleans East Hospital. Outdoor time is close at hand at Joe Brown Park and the adjacent New Orleans East libraries provide community programming and resources.

Commuters appreciate access to I 10 into downtown New Orleans and the Central Business District, while nearby Gentilly offers additional shopping and dining. With ongoing investment across New Orleans East, understanding local trends in pricing, insurance, and renovation is essential.
